I chose this way:
'You can alternatively use ndisgtk to install drivers to the system.' Installed ndisgtk, run it, pointed to the driver location, the tool ran and wifi networks were available.
I chose the network, entered the password and acer extensa 2300 got connected. This post is completed adn posted while using wlan, thanks to all who contributed.
